tb.inc.php の tb_save() で ping 受信時に件数が 10 件増える

  • ページ: BugTrack
  • 投稿者: 閑舎
  • 優先順位: 低
  • 状態: 完了
  • カテゴリー: 本体バグ
  • 投稿日: 2004-05-23 (日) 23:49:02
  • バージョン:

関連

  • 同内容: BugTrack/638 TrackBack受信件数が多く表示される

メッセージ

tb.inc.php,v 1.9 の 120 行目あたりなんですが、

{
  $line = preg_replace('/[,\n\r]/s', '', $line); // 追加
  fwrite($fp,join(',',$line)."\n");
}

のようになるとうれしいかもと思い、投稿します。 というのは、他の blog から ping を送信すると、 どうも展開後 \n や \r が含まれているので、 これを PukiWiki が受け取ると、件数が 1 件どころか、改行の数分増えるので、 一挙に 10 件増えたりするんです。 trackback の仕様は調べず言ってます。 また、PukiWiki 相互間では問題ないようなので、却下されてもいいです。


  • ありがとうございます。BugTrack/638 と同内容の様ですので、あちらで継続させていただきます。 -- henoheno 2004-07-31 (土) 21:35:38

トップ   編集 凍結 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 検索 最終更新   ヘルプ   最終更新のRSS
Last-modified: 2004-07-31 (土) 21:35:38
Site admin: PukiWiki Development Team

PukiWiki 1.5.2+ © 2001-2019 PukiWiki Development Team. Powered by PHP 5.6.40-0+deb8u7. HTML convert time: 0.197 sec.

OSDN